Beberapa Situs Penyedia Penyimpanan File Terbesar

One Drive 

One Drive Cloud Storage. One Drive adalah salah satu situs cloud storage yang dapat membantu anda menyimpan berbagai file, data dan dokumen apapun yang anda inginkan

One Drive adalah salah satu situs cloud storage yang dapat membantu anda menyimpan berbagai file, data dan dokumen apapun yang anda inginkan. Karena situs ini menyediakan kapasitas ruang penyimpanan yang cukup besar. Setiap akun gratis akan diberikan kapasitas ruang 15GB. Sehingga anda dapat menyimpan dokumen, foto atau apapun yang anda ingin simpan disana. 

One Drive juga memungkinkan anda untuk membuat, mengedit dan berbagi data secara online. Hanya saja kelemahan dari One Drive adalah cara berbagi file atau dokumen yang agak sedikit ribet dibanding cloud storage atau media penyimpanan online lainnya. Namun tidak ada salahnya jika situs ini menjadi pertimbangan anda. 

Google Drive 

Cloud Storage alternative terbaik yang kedua adalah Google Drive

Cloud Storage alternatif terbaik yang kedua adalah Google Drive. Situs ini juga menawarkan 15GB ruang penyimpanan gratis atau tanpa biaya sepeserpun untuk anda. Namun hanya saja, kapasitas ruang ini akan dibagi antara akun Google Drive, Gmail dan Foto Google+ anda. Jika anda ingin memiliki ruang penyimpanan tambahan disana, anda dapat membelinya dengan biaya tambahan sendiri. 

Saya sudah menjadi penggunan aktif Gmail selama kurang lebih 5 tahun, dan sampai sekarang kapasitas Google Drive akun saya masih 85%, itu artinya kapasitas 15GB bukanlah kapasitas yang kecil. Anda dapat menyimpan banyak file dan dokumen untuk dapat menghabiskan kapasitas penyimpanan gratis ini. 

Box.com 

Box Cloud Storage

Box.com juga menyediakan kapasitas ruang penyimpanan 10GB sebagai bentuk layanan gratisnya. Sehingga Box.com juga dapat menjadi alternatif cloud storage gratis yang wajib anda pertimbangkan. Situs Box.com memberikan fitur sinkronisasi yang sangat mudah, sehingga anda dapat mengakses file anda menggunakan tablet atau ponsel kesayangan anda dimana saja. 

Kelemahan dari Box.com adalah pada ukuran file yang akan anda bagikan (share) terbatas maksimum 250MB. Jadi jika file anda melebihi kapasitas tersebut, maka anda harus membaginya menjadi beberapa partisi terlebih dahulu. 

Team Drive 

Team Drive Cloud Storage

Situs ini menyediakan ruang penyimpanan 10GB secara gratis. Team Drive juga memberikan fitur sinkronisasi data dari komputer atau laptop, dan juga berbagai file jenis musik, dokumen, gambar atau juga folder kepada siapa saja dengan sangat mudah. 
Team Drive juga menawarkan fitur keamanan yang sangat tinggi untuk anda. Karena situs ini memberikan fitur Encrypting Users Data. Sehingga setiap pengguna dapat memutuskan siapa saja yang dapat mengakses filenya yang telah ia simpan. 

Amazon Cloud Drive 


Amazaon Cloud menawarkan ruang penyimpanan yang lumayan cukup besar, yaitu 5GB penyimpanan secara gratis dibandingkan Dropbox hanya 2GB saja. Anda juga dapat dengan mudah menambahkan foto secara langsung dari ponsel dan juga tablet kesayangan anda dengan sangat mudah. Cara kerja Amazon Cloud Drive ini hampir sama seperti cloud storage pada umumnya, yaitu memberikan kemudahan akses file dimanapun kepada para penggunanya, dengan catatanselama dalam jangkauan internet

Salah satu fitur yang menarik dari Amazon Cloud Drive adalah gambar yang telah anda simpan di sana akan selalu dapat anda akses dengan ponsel atau tablet anda, sekalipun gambar original dari ponsel anda telah anda hapus. Amazon Cloud Drive juga memiliki fitur back-up secara otomatis, sehingga gambar anda akan tersimpan secara otomatis dan juga sangat aman, sekalipun jika ponsel anda hilang atau rusak. 

Wuala

Wuala Cloud Storage

Wuala menyediakan ruang penyimpanan 5GB secara gratis. Yang memungkinkan anda untuk dapat dengan mudah menyimpan dan berbagi file apa saja disana. Wuala juga memberikan fitur enkripsi otomatis sebelum file anda diupload. Bahkan password setiap user Wuala tidak akan pernah dikirimkan kepada siapapun, bahkan kepada karyawan Wuala sekalipun. Sehingga ini menjadi fitur keamanan tambahan bagi anda. 

Wuala juga memiliki system backup yang sangat baik, serta fitur file versioning. Sehingga memudahkan anda untuk mengakses file versi lama anda, jika file anda hilang atau tidak sengaja terhapus. 

Cloudme 


Penyimpanan online alternative berikutnya adalah Cloudme. Ruang penyimpanan yang disediakan mencapai 19GB secara gratis. Namun ukuran file yang dapat anda simpan maksimum berukuran 150MB setiap filenya. Fitur unik yang ditawarkan Cloudme adalah, anda dapat membuat sebuah fitur desktop cloud sendiri disana. 

Fitur lainnya yang disediakan oleh Cloudme adalah dapat melakukan sinkronisasi dari spesific folder untuk perangkat/device tertentu. Sehingga anda dapat membedakan anta file pribadi dan file pekerjaan kantor anda secara terpisah. 


Cloudme Stream Music

Ingin Mendengarkan Music Streaming Saat Bepergian? 
Dengan Cloudme anda akan dapat membuat sebuah music library (perpustakaan musik), yang dapat anda akses dan anda putar di mobil, TV, komputer, laptop dan juga ponsel kesayangan anda. Bahkan anda dapat berbagi musik kesayangan anda tersebut kepada keluarga dan orang-orang yang anda kehendaki dengan mudah.

SpiderOak 

SpiderOak Cloud Storage

Cloud Storage Alternatif berikutnya adalah SpidorOak. Situs ini menyediakan ruang kapasitas 2GB secara gratis dan juga 100GB dengan biaya tambahan $10.00 yang harus anda bayar setiap bulannya. SpiderOak juga memberikan fitur back-up secara aman, sehingga anda tidak perlu khawatir kehilangan file anda. 

Sinkronisasi dan berbagi file juga sangat mudah di Cloud SpiderOak. Anda dapat mengakses file anda melalui berbagai media perangkat seperti tablet dan juga ponsel anda. Semua file yang anda upload di SpiderOak dilindungi dengan pasword, sehingga anda tidak perlu khawatir file anda akan dilihat oleh orang lain. 

Copy.com 

Copy.com cloud storage

Copy.com menyediakan ruang penyimpanan 15GB secara gratis. Situs ini juga memberikan kemudahan kepada para penggunanya untuk mengakses file atau data yang telah disimpan di Copy.com melalui berbagai perangkat, seperti komputer atau laptop, ponsel dan juga tablet. Tidak ada batasan besar ukuran file yang harus anda upload, sehingga anda bebas mengupload file anda disana. Bahkan situs ini juga memberikan jaminan privasi yang tinggi. 

Satu hal yang menarik dari Copy.com adalah anda dapat berbagi file secara bersama. Sebagai contoh jika ada dua orang berbagi file dengan total kapasitas 10GB secara bersama, maka anda hanya dihitung menggunakan 5GB, karena 5GB dibebankan oleh user lainnya yang melakukan sharing file tersebut. 

Pengertian Dan Fungsi Root Android


Pengertian Dan Fungsi Root Android Dan Kelebihan - Kali Ini Saya mau Bagi Tips Juga Untuk Android Anda, karena Bahas Harga Android Terus Gak bakal Seru kalau Kita Tidak Membokar System Android kita, Karena pada Dasarnya Android itu Komputer Portable. pada Kesempatan Kali ini Saya Mau Membahas Pengertian Dan Fungsi Root Android Dan Kelebihan Dan Kekurangan Root Mungkin kalian Sudah Sering Denger Yang Namanya Root Di Android, Atau Di Manapun Pasti Pernah Denger yang Namanya Rooting atau Root, Apalagi Anda Jurusan Komputer Pasti tahu Dong Root Itu apa, Tapi bagaimana Yang Belom tahu ? Maka dari itu saya mau Berbagi ke anda Agar anda tau Pengertian Root dan Fungsi Root Android 

Pengertian Dan Fungsi Root Android Dan Kelebihan


Pengertian Root Android 

Root atau Akar, Atau bahasa Gampangnya kita adalah Inti dari Suatu Daerah, Atau System, Atau Pun itu Inti Mesin, Yang Namanya inti Pasti sangat penting sekali bukan, Dan Pastinya sangat Di Lindungi Sekali karena kalau Kita Tidak Melindungi Inti/Root Tersebut Otomatis Fisik atau Komponen bukan Intinya akan Roboh. Root Adalah Suatu System Account "Home/Inti" Yang Memiliki Full Akses Kekuasaan Absolut Agar Bisa Mengakses Dan Mengeksesuki Semua Aplikasi Dan File, Seperti yang saya bilang diatas bahwa dia adalah Inti atua Pak Kepala, Berarti Ia berhak Untuk Menghapus atau Mengupdate Data yang ada Di Android kita, Karena pada Dasarnya Android itu Berbasis Sistem Operasi Berbasis Linux maka disana Di Terapkan System Root Android. Root Ini Memiliki akses Keseluruh Aplikasi yang ada Di Android, Ia bisa mengeksekusi File dan Aplikasi Yang Tidak bisa di Eksekusi bila kita Hanya menggunkan Quest Atau User Biasa, Kalau Anda ingin Nge-root Android anda bisa lakukan Karena Dengan Mengeroot System Android anda, Anda Bisa menghapus File Yang Tidak penting, Bisa Mengganti Tampilan Android kita agar Lebih cantik Bisa mengetik system operasi Android kita, Untuk Caranya Bisa langsung Klik Disini 

Fungsi Root Android

Fungsi Root Android itu sebenarnya banyak sekali, Manfaat yang di berikan juga tidak sedikit Karena Kenapa saya bilang banyak Manfaatnya karena Root adalah Gedung inti yang dapat mengcontrol semua aktifitas Yang ada di android kita dan juga kita bisa mengeksekusi Aktifitas tersebut tanpa Membutuhkan Perangkat Apapun Dan Tanpa Syarat macam-macam Dengan anda Mengeroot System Operasi Android anda, Anda akan Memiliki Hak akses Penuh Terhadap Android anda, Anda bisa Mengganti Tampilan saat Booting atau Reboot atau anda juga ingin Change Data Aplikasi ke Micro SD anda, itu semua bisa di lakukan Dengan Cara Anda Mengeroot android Anda, Fungsi Root android itu Adalah Untuk Mengeksekusi dan Merunning,Mengupdate,Merubah sepenuhnya HP Android Kita 

Dengan Kita root Android Kita, kita Bisa memanfaatkan Fungsi Root Android kita dengan sangat baik. Anda Akan Mendapatkan Full Akses Android Anda, Dengan Cara Root Android Anda, Bila Anda Memiliki Android Dengna Memory Internalnya kecil Anda bisa
menambahkanya Menggunakan Memory Eksternal dan Anda Juga bisa Move Data Aplikasi Anda Ke Micro SD agar Internal Anda Tidak Termakan Terlalu banyak, Fungsi Root Android Itu sangat Banyak sekali Kawan, Anda Juga bisa Swap RAM anda jadi Lebih Besar jadi Anda tidak akan Leg Bermain Game Online atau Offline Di Android anda, Fungsi Root Android Pada dasarnya Untuk Merubah Kesuruluhan System Android kita, Atua Custom Android kita Dengna Versi Kita sendiri Kalau Anda bisa editnya, Kalau tidka bisa ya Download Punya orang lalu pasang 

Memang Cara Paling Mantap Untuk Mengedit Android kita Agar Bagus Tampilanya Yaitu Langsung ke System Intinya jadi Kita Bisa Edit sepenuhnya dan juga Anda bisa Menghapus Aplikasi Bawaan Android Atua Pabrik, Karena Yang Dapat mengeksekusi Aplikasi Pabrik hanya Root Saja Quest Atau User tidak Di Berikan Akses Full Hanya beberpaa akses yang di Berikan Oleh Root Ke User jadi kita memiliki Ke terbatasan System tapi lain kalau kita sudah masuk ke Root ADMIN 

Kelebihan Root Android Kelebihan yang di dapat dari Kita mengeroot android kita, Maka anda akan Mendapatkan, Akses Tidak terbatas ke Semua system Android Kita, Dapat Menghapus Aplikasi Bawaan Android dari Pabrik Tanpa Merusak memory kita, Dan juga anda dapat memindahkan Installasi Aplikasi anda dari Memory Internal Ke Memory Eksternal, Sehingga Memory Internal anda bisa lebih leluasa dan anda juga dapat menginstall banyak Aplikasi dan Mempercepat Kinerja Prosessor kita, Anda mendapatkan Akses Backup aplikasi jadi kalau Mau Install Ulang System Android anda maka bisa Anda backup dulu sebelum D install, Anda dapat Bisa merubah Tampilan Memulai Install Cosroom , Bisa Menambah Memory RAM atau bisa di Sebut Temen Saya itu SWAP android jadi Lebih leluasa anda Memainkan Android anda 

Kekurangan Root Android, Kalau Dia Punya kelebihan Otomatis Punya kekurangan Dong, Di Dunia ini gak ada yang sempurna, Cie Curhat :D. Lanjut, Kekurangan Di Android kalau Kita Mengeroot android kita maka kita akan mendapatkan Beberapa Dampan yang Cukup Ekstrim Bagi android kita, Yang Pertama Bila Anda root. Garansi HP Android Hilang, Bila Anda mau Root Android anda, Maka Anda harus berani Merelakan Garansi HP android anda Hilang Karena Semua Vendor Posnel Mengatakan Bahwa HP android yang Telah Di Buka systemnya atau Rooting maka akan Hilang masa Garansinya, Jadi kalau Kita Utak Atik File android kita dan bila ada Kerusakan Maka Android kita tidak akan Di berikan Garansi karena Vendor tidak mau bertanggung jawab Bila HP android kita sudah Di Root Atau di buka Systemnya, Untuk Yang Kedua Sangat Mudah sekali Terserang Virus dan Malware: Kalau Anda Membuka System Android yang sudah di Protek maka ada Kemungkinana Anda bisa termasukan Virus, Tapi Tenang aja karena Kita itu Open Source jadi semua File yang Kedetek virus akan bisa kita hapus Langsung Tanpa menggunakan Anti Virus karena system operasi kita Masih Berbasis Open Source, Ketiga Bootloop Android Kalau anda mau Root Anda juga harus berani Tanggung Akibat gagal Fungsi atau Bootloop, Android anda bisa Gagal Fungsi Bila systemnya ktia Ganti atau Kita edit, Kalau kita ada kesalahan data maka akan Terjadi Bootloop di mana android kita tidak dapat Mengakses ke Desktop Portable nya
